Both Quadriceps and Bone–Patellar Tendon–Bone Autografts Improve Postoperative Stability and Functional Outcomes After Anterior Cruciate Ligament Reconstruction: A Systematic Review
Purpose: To compare postoperative knee stability, functional outcomes, and complications after an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) reconstruction using bone–patellar tendon–bone (BPTB) versus quadriceps tendon autograft.
